Book Description

P and upPlayhouse Disney
Stanley wishes he could spend more time with his dad. Maybe if he had a lion for a father, then he'd have someone to play with all day long! But after spending time with a lion family, Stanley realizes he does have the best dad in the whole world.

"Daddy Lion" is one of a set of "Stanley" television series books. This one is based on the TV story "Daddy Pride." In this story, Stanley is upset because his Daddy won't play with him all the time. He decides that he's going to get a lion to be his father. It'll be great -- he'll have somebody to play lion with all the time. Dennis, however, doesn't think that this is a great idea. He joins Stanley for a trip into "The Great Big Book of Everything" where Stanley learns that living with lions isn't exactly what he thought it was.

The "Stanley" series does it again. Another great story sure to entertain and inform fans of the show. The book comes with a page of facts about lions, as well as a "count the lions" game.
